Mateo’s old bedroom was a square with integer dimensions. His new bedroom is 3 feet wider and 2 feet longer. The increase in area is 46 ft^2. What were the dimensions of Mateo’s old bedroom?
Let x be the length of Mateo's old bedroom, then its width is also x since it is a square.
The new bedroom's length is x + 2 and its width is x + 3. The area of the new bedroom is (x + 2)(x + 3).
We know that the increase in area is 46 ft^2, so we can write an equation:
(x + 2)(x + 3) - x^2 = 46
Expanding the left side of the equation and simplifying, we get:
x^2 + 5x - 40 = 0
Factoring, we get:
(x + 8)(x - 5) = 0
Since the dimensions of the bedroom must be positive, we can discard the negative solution x = -8. Therefore, the length of Mateo's old bedroom is x = 5 feet, and its dimensions are 5 ft by 5 ft.

The equation m = 3b represents the time in minutes (m) it takes a chef to cook a certain number of bacon cheeseburgers (b).
Determine the constant of proportionality.
A. 3
B. 6
C. one third
D. 1
For the given equation:
m = 3b
The constant of proportionality is 3, so the correct option is A.
How to determine the constant of proportionality?
After a small search on the internet, I've found that this question asks for the constant of proportionality.
Remember that a proportional relation is of the form:
y = k*x
Where k is the constant of proportionality, and x and y are the variables.
Here the relation is:
m = 3*b
Where m and b are the variables, then the remaining coefficient is the constant of proportionality, which is 3.
In this way, we can see that the correct option is A.
